SI > Sonic RecordNow > new version not installed

#1 Post by XCoalMiner » Fri Apr 14, 2006 12:39 pm

Today the Software Installer reported that a new version of Sonic RecordNow was available.

I clicked yes, downloaded it, and the SI removed the previous version (7.22) and did not install the new version (7.32). That is a problem because the new version release notes states that the update only works if there's a version installed already.

SI does does not list either the old or the new version, so I can't re-install the old version. This was one of my main tools to backup data to CD, and now I can't rollback to the old ver or install the new ver.

Tried running the executable that SI downloaded, rn732.exe. Install appears to start, even appears to nearly finish (as indicated by progress bar) but install dialog disappears and nothing in installed. (Small consolation, I still have the Sonic express labeler installed). But in Program Files\Sonic\RecordNow!\ there's nothing present, except a folder named "Update Manager" dated a few months ago.

Any log files or notes I can view to see what happened, or where can I locate old version to install?

#4 Post by XCoalMiner » Fri Apr 14, 2006 3:44 pm

Thanks for that tip. I was able to reinstall version 6.7.0, which was the original version.

rn732.exe is the guilty party here, not SI. Executing rn732.exe removes whatever version of RecordNow is installed on my system.

Unfortunately, I'm in limbo. I can't install the latest 7.32 version, and I can't locate an install package for the last known good version, which was 7.22 (I believe). 7.22 worked without issue, and I'd like to get back to it (anyone able to locate it on Lenovo's suport site?). SI only reports 7.32 available, 6.7.0 installed, but nothing in between (and I had a few versions in between).

The readme for 7.32 has a list of Supported devices, but the original part number for the CD-RW/DVD-ROM (part 13N6781, FRU 92P6581) shipped with my T41 does not match anything on that list. I'm not clear if that is the problem, or if the part numbers have changed over time or due to the IBM/Lenovo change. In any case, I don't think the install routine would just blindly remove the previous version, that seems to be the real problem here.

Despite the note, it does not rely on an existing installed version to install correctly. Something on your system is stopping it installing, which is probably why SI wasn't able to install it for you.

SI installed it fine for me on a T43 with an existing copy of v723 in place, and I have also done a manual install from the v732 .exe file on a T41 that had not previously had a copy of Record Now on it.

Thanks for the insights. I got it installed after quite a bit of poking around.

Had to completely disable Microsoft AntiSpyware to finally get it to install. That was after seeing some messages in the event viewer that led me to enable two services (Universal Plug and Play Device Host, and SSDP). I also had the service Webroot Spy Sweeper Engine running, even though Spy Sweeper subscription expired 12 months ago. I don't think the Spy Sweeper service played into this, though.

UPnP and SSDP are disabled again after install. Also, rebooted since install to be sure everything works, and it does. This was not easy to troubleshoot.
